The Tsui Group is seeking a qualified and experienced Graphic Designer - Reporting Manager to join our aviation team in Los Angeles County. The Graphic Designer III - Reporting Manager integrates visual communications, document production, and construction reporting to improve transparency, compliance, and stakeholder understanding of scope, schedule, cost, safety, quality, and operational impacts. Working closely with Project Managers, Office Engineers, Field Engineers, Construction Managers, Community Relations, and Regulatory/Compliance teams, the Graphic Designer - Reporting Manager ensures all materials adhere to LAWA branding, accessibility, and records management standards, and are published through approved channels. Essential Job Duties: Program Communications & Design Plan, design, and produce ads, notices, posters, pamphlets, displays, signage, exhibits, and web content to support project communications, public information, outreach events, and regulatory requirements. Design and layout brochures, report covers, infographics, and slide decks for technical and administrative reports and presentations. Develop exhibit boards and presentation materials for briefings, stakeholder meetings, public hearings, and community events. Reporting & Data Visualization Translate schedule, cost, risk, safety, and quality data into charts, graphs, dashboards, and projection slides suitable for executive briefings and public display. Maintain standardized visual templates and style guides for monthly, quarterly, and ad‑hoc reports. Partner with Project Controls to ensure KPI accuracy and consistency between narrative and visualizations. Document Production & Records Coordinate the compilation, editing, and final production of reports (e.g., Monthly Construction Report, Board/Commission packages, progress bulletins, traffic advisories). Ensure all materials comply with branding, accessibility (e.g., ADA/Section 508), and records retention requirements. Manage version control and archive final deliverables within the PMIS (e.g., PMWeb) and shared repositories. Stakeholder Coordination Work cross‑functionally with Project Managers, Office Engineers, Field staff , Safety/Quality, Environmental, and Community Relations to gather accurate source content and approvals. Support meeting logistics (agendas, exhibits, handouts) and capture acti on items relating to communications deliverables. Other Duties as Assigned Assist with photography/videography coordination and basic asset management as required. Professional Experience Level/Other Qualifications: 15+ years experience in preparing graphic display, descriptive charts, brochures or maps for commercial or public use. Experience in AEC communications/design, construction reporting, or technical publications, preferably on complex, phased programs in active facilities (airport experience preferred). Portfolio demonstrating report design, infographics/data visualization, signage, and exhibit materials for technical audiences and the public. Excellent written and oral communication skills; ability to edit technical content for clarity and audience appropriateness. Must have a self-starter attitude with proactive, results-oriented focus; and willing and capable to assume additional responsibilities Must be able to interface with a variety of people with different technical levels and educational backgrounds Must be detail oriented and highly organized Education/Training: Bachelor’s Degree in Graphics Desings, Art, or related field preferred. Hardware/Software Knowledge: Design/Visualization: Adobe Creative Cloud (InDesign, Illustrator, Photoshop), Acrobat Pro; Bluebeam; Tableau/Power BI (or equivalent) for dashboards; MS Visio. Office/Presentation: Microsoft 365 (Word, PowerPoint, Excel), Teams/SharePoint; strong skills in template building and advanced formatting.
